There was a question on one of the panels about this. A guy asked if there would be different looks for the top items, so everyone wouldn't end up in the same equipment eventually. More green skull caps, plz!
The answer was that they hadn't decided yet, but that they were worrying more about making lots of different items to give players more comparable eq choices than about tweaking the appearance of every single item in 50 ways.
